WebFeb 11, 2024 · Warm light. If a light gives you sunset vibes, its color temperature is on the warmer side. Most yellow, orange, or red lights provide warm lighting, which encompasses all color temperatures less than 4000K. Warm lighting is great for a low-key nighttime read, but it’s too relaxing to work well as study lighting. Web2 days ago · This recent study looked further into M82 X-2 and discovered that it consumed up to 1.5 times the earth's mass, which is equivalent to around 9 billion trillion tons of … WebThe 27 chromatic colors, plus 3 brightness-matched achromatic colors, were presented via an LED display. Participants (N = 62) viewed each color for 30 s and then rated their current emotional state (valence and arousal). Skin conductance and heart rate were measured continuously. The emotion ratings showed that saturated and bright colors were ...
